Debunking the Myth: Do Phone Cases Affect Phone Signal?

Mar 29, 2023
In the realm of mobile technology, smartphones have become an indispensable part of our lives. With their sleek designs and advanced features, these devices are an extension of ourselves. However, one question that often arises is whether phone cases affect phone signal quality. Some argue that encasing a smartphone in a protective cover might hinder signal reception, while others dismiss it as a mere myth. In this article, we delve into this topic to uncover the truth about phone cases and their impact on phone signals. Understanding Phone Signal To comprehend the potential effects of phone cases on signal strength, it's essential to understand how phone signals work. Mobile devices communicate via radio frequency (RF) signals, which transmit data to and from cellular towers. The strength of these signals determines the quality of call reception, internet connectivity, and overall performance. Various factors can influence signal strength, including distance from the tower, obstacles, and interference. Types of Phone Cases Phone cases come in different shapes, sizes, and materials, ranging from thin, transparent covers to bulky, rugged protectors. The impact on signal strength can vary depending on the type of case used. Let's explore the two main categories: Conductive Cases: Some phone cases are designed with conductive materials, such as metal or foil. These cases may interfere with the smartphone's ability to receive and transmit signals effectively. Metal cases, in particular, can act as a barrier, blocking or reflecting RF signals, leading to degraded signal quality. Non-Conductive Cases: The majority of phone cases on the market are made from non-conductive materials like plastic, silicone, or rubber. These materials do not interfere with the transmission of signals and, in theory, should not affect signal strength. Examining the Impact While there is a theoretical possibility that certain phone cases could affect signal strength, in practice, the impact is often negligible. Modern smartphones are designed with antennas that are placed strategically to optimize signal reception and transmission. Manufacturers take into account potential signal interference from cases and other factors during the design process. Research and user experiences suggest that non-conductive cases generally do not significantly affect signal strength. These cases allow radio waves to pass through unhindered, ensuring reliable connectivity. However, it's worth noting that extremely thick or poorly designed non-conductive cases may still have a marginal impact on signal strength, albeit rare. On the other hand, conductive cases, especially those made from metal, can potentially interfere with signal reception. Metal cases act as a shield, reflecting or absorbing radio waves, resulting in reduced signal strength. If you notice a significant decline in signal quality after using a metal case, consider switching to a non-conductive alternative. Optimizing Signal Strength If you encounter signal issues while using a phone case, there are a few steps you can take to optimize signal strength: Case Selection: Choose a well-designed, non-conductive case from reputable manufacturers. Look for positive user reviews and feedback regarding signal strength. Case Removal: If you experience weak signal reception in a specific area, removing the case temporarily may help improve connectivity. Signal Boosters: In areas with poor signal coverage, consider using external signal boosters or repeaters. These devices can enhance signal strength regardless of whether a case is used. The idea that phone cases universally hinder phone signal strength is largely a myth. Non-conductive cases, which are the most common type, typically have little to no impact on signal reception or transmission. However, conductive cases made from metal materials can potentially disrupt signals. When choosing a phone case, opt for a well-designed, non-conductive option from a trusted manufacturer to ensure both protection and optimal signal strength. Remember, if you encounter signal issues, other factors like network coverage and your smartphone's internal components may be at play. How to choose the right phone case?

Mar 22, 2023
Choosing the right phone case depends on a few factors, including your lifestyle, phone model, and personal preferences. Here are some tips to help you choose the right phone case: Determine the level of protection you need: If you lead an active lifestyle or work in a rugged environment, you may need a heavy-duty case that offers maximum protection against drops, scratches, and impact. If you are looking for a slim, lightweight case, then a minimalist case might be a better option. Check the compatibility with your phone model: Make sure the phone case you choose is compatible with your phone model. This will ensure that all the buttons, ports, and other features are easily accessible and that the case provides the right fit. Consider the design: Phone cases come in a variety of designs, from solid colors to patterns and prints. Choose a design that reflects your personality and style. Look for additional features: Some phone cases come with additional features, such as a built-in screen protector, kickstand, or card holder. Consider these features if they are important to you. Read reviews: Before making a purchase, read reviews from other users to get an idea of the case's quality, durability, and overall performance. Ultimately, the right phone case will depend on your individual needs and preferences. How to clean a clear phone case?

Mar 22, 2023
Cleaning a clear phone case is an important task that can help keep your phone looking its best. Here are some steps to follow when cleaning your clear phone case: Remove your phone from the case: Before cleaning the case, remove your phone from it to avoid getting any cleaning solution on your phone. Use a soft cloth: Use a soft, lint-free cloth or microfiber cloth to clean the case. Avoid using abrasive materials, such as paper towels, as they can scratch the case. Wipe with a damp cloth: Dampen the cloth with warm water and gently wipe the case. Avoid using hot water, as it can damage the case. Use mild soap if necessary: If the case is particularly dirty or has stubborn stains, you can add a small amount of mild soap to the warm water. Make sure to rinse the case thoroughly with warm water afterwards. Dry the case: After cleaning the case, use a dry cloth to remove any excess water. Allow the case to air dry completely before placing your phone back in it. Avoid harsh chemicals: Avoid using harsh chemicals such as bleach or alcohol to clean your clear phone case, as they can damage the case material. By following these simple steps, you can keep your clear phone case looking clean and transparent, which can enhance the overall look of your phone.

Keeping Transparent Phone Cases Clean

Apr 28, 2020
Transparent phone cases are a great choice for smartphone users who desire the added protection of a case without having to give up too much form factor. Initially, a transparent case looks perfect, lacking a single sign of a blemish or scratch. But many owners find that over time, transparent smartphone cases start to look dingy. They increasingly become covered in scratches and smudges and the once colorless plastic gradually develops a yellow hue. But don't worry, not all these changes are inevitable or irreversible. Here are four ways to keep your transparent case clean longer. KEEP KEYS AWAY One of the simplest ways to minimize case micro scratching is to avoid keeping your phone in the same pocket as keys or other metal objects. As you move around throughout the day, such metal objects will inevitably rub up against your smartphone case and from this, scratches occur. SOAP AND WATER Regularly removing your phone case and gently scrubbing the interior and exterior with soap and water will help lift dirt, smudges, and oil off the plastic, keeping your case cleaner for longer. Unfortunately, soap and water will do little to undo a transparent case which has developed a yellow hue as this color shift is generally caused by UV damage and oxidation which soap and water cannot fix. ALCOHOL OR BLEACH WATER For troublesome stains that refuse to be removed by soap and water, alcohol is an excellent and powerful cleaning alternative. A clear spirit with a high ABV such as vodka will work best. For an even more powerful cleaning agent, one can use bleach water. While bleach water generally cannot fully undo a yellow hue, bleach does have inherent whitening properties and can lighten the color of a case. Be sure to dilute the bleach with plenty of water and wear gloves whenever working with the liquid as it can be dangerous. KEEP YOUR PHONE OUT OF THE SUN One of the primary causes of a phone case turning yellow is damage from ultraviolet radiation. A simple method to minimize this damage is not to leave your phone out in the sun. In particular, do not leave your phone flipped over with the transparent case allowed to bathe in sunlight. Overall, scratches, smudges, and stains on a transparent smartphone case can all be prevented or treated with proper care. On the other hand, the gradual yellowing of the plastic cannot fully be prevented or fixed; however, keeping a phone case out of harsh sunlight and using bleach water can help work to keep a case transparent and colorless longer. iPhone SE 2020: The 2020 Apple Budget Phone

Apr 27, 2020
Apple released the iPhone SE 2020 on the 24th of April, which is a reboot of the iconic iPhone SE from 2016. While the two share the name, there is little to suggest it's a sequel to the 2016 original SE. The phone looks like an iPhone 8 with the brains and power of the iPhone 11. 1. Design It comes with a 4.7-inch retina display with a true tone. It ships in three colors; black, white, and product red. With 2020 phones pushing the screen to body ratio higher, the iPhone SE feels dated with its forehead and chin bezels.  It rocks the body of an iPhone 8, even with its one camera at the back. The chassis is made of aluminum, with a glass front and back. With glass front and back, you will need a cover to protect your phone from accidental falls. The phone also has ip67 water and dust resistance, so it will survive water splashes and brief submersion in water. 2. Comes With the A13 Bionic Chip The phone rocks the iPhone 11 A13 Bionic chip, which puts its performance up there with the high-end flagship phones like the iPhone 11 which cost starts at 699. The A13 Bionic chip is the most powerful and fastest in any iPhone made, which makes the experience when using it fluid and fast. 3. Touch ID is Back! In the age of gestures and face unlock, touch id feels old and dated. For many, it's still a great and secure way to unlock your phone, sign in to apps and pay for goods without getting your credit card out. The phone uses a haptic touch for quick actions and contextual menus. 4. Battery The phone comes with an 1821 mAh battery as the iPhone 8. With the A13 Bionic cheap inside, the device is more power sufficient. The iPhone SE battery lasts 13 hours and 8 hours when watching and streaming videos, and 40 hours when listening to audio. It comes with wireless charging, which neither the iPhone SE nor iPhone 8 has. It also has fast charging using the out of box 18W power adapter or higher. It can fast-charge up to 50 percent in 30 min. 5. Camera The iPhone SE has only two cameras. The 12-megapixel rear camera has optical image stabilization (OIS) and has support for slow-mo video and time-lapse video. It can also record video at 4k video up to 60 fps. The 7-megapixel front-facing camera supports portrait mode. The phone compares well with iPhone 8 when it comes to design, but that's the end of it. The internals of the phone is from the iPhone 11, which put the old looking phone at par with the new models in the market. The iPhone SE  ships in 64gb base model at $399, 128gb model at $449, and the 256gb model at $549. The downside. One would expect that Apple would do something about the model and reduce the bezels on the front side of the phone. It feels like we took a trip back into 2016. With OLED screens manufacturing getting better and cheaper, Apple decided to use the LCD screens. The camera on the SE doesn't have a night mode, which most 2020 phones have. The A13 Bionic chip is capable of handling night mode. Overall, the iPhone SE 2020 is a good phone and a bargain at that price point.
